An Add On CD Calculator is a powerful financial tool designed to help investors estimate the growth of a Certificate of Deposit (CD) that allows additional contributions over time. Unlike traditional CDs, where you deposit a fixed amount once and let it grow, an add-on CD gives you the flexibility to add more money during the investment term.
This calculator helps users understand how their savings will grow with regular deposits, interest compounding, and time. It is especially useful for individuals who want a safe investment option while still maintaining the ability to increase their investment periodically.

What is an Add On CD?
An Add On Certificate of Deposit is a special type of savings account offered by banks where:
- You start with an initial deposit
- You earn fixed interest over a set term
- You are allowed to add more money during the term
- Interest continues to compound on the growing balance
This makes it more flexible than a standard CD.

Key Formula Logic
The calculation is based on compound interest with recurring contributions:
- Future Value of Initial Deposit
- Future Value of Periodic Add-On Deposits
The general logic is:
FV = P(1 + r/n)^(nt) + PMT × [( (1 + r/n)^(nt) - 1 ) / (r/n)]
Where:
- FV = Future Value
- P = Initial deposit
- PMT = Regular add-on contribution
- r = Annual interest rate (decimal)
- n = Compounding frequency per year
- t = Time in years
Inputs Required in the Calculator
To use an Add On CD Calculator, users must enter:
1. Initial Deposit
The starting amount placed into the CD.
2. Interest Rate
Annual interest rate offered by the bank.
3. Term Length
Duration of the CD in years or months.
4. Compounding Frequency
How often interest is calculated (monthly, quarterly, annually).
5. Add-On Contribution Amount
Regular deposits added during the term.
6. Contribution Frequency
Monthly, weekly, or quarterly deposits.

Practical Example
Let’s assume:
- Initial Deposit: $5,000
- Interest Rate: 4.5% annually
- Term: 5 years
- Monthly Add-On: $200
- Compounding: Monthly
Result:
- Total Deposits: $17,000
- Estimated Interest Earned: $2,800+
- Final Value: ~$19,800+
This shows how regular contributions significantly increase savings growth.
